About Swan Meadow School

Swan Meadow School is a public elementary school in Oakland, MD, part of Garrett County Public Schools, serving approximately 48 students in grades Kindergarten-8th with a 24:1 student-teacher ratio.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 5.6 out of 10 and ranks #862 of 1,363 schools in MD. State assessment records show 67%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025) and 73%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025).
